Output e28f7d1da60cc55ff7295074f4af984c7f2d14dbf6f42815e730ab5c3b1123a0:0

value
3760881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c05b119ead397f5a0482c694142e6fb72e51f7c OP_EQUAL
address
37APHXWjGLuuUuduB8AUBkAtao51r9TXiK
transaction
e28f7d1da60cc55ff7295074f4af984c7f2d14dbf6f42815e730ab5c3b1123a0
spent
true